From cafb51263a5a0fc64493504c8a93c7e9809b228d Mon Sep 17 00:00:00 2001 From: dd32 Date: Mon, 19 Apr 2010 12:03:01 +0000 Subject: [PATCH] Canonical redirect to correct location if rss2 is not default feed. wp-feed.php redirection to default feed type instad of rss2. Props solarissmoke. Fixes #13047 git-svn-id: http://svn.automattic.com/wordpress/trunk@14162 1a063a9b-81f0-0310-95a4-ce76da25c4cd --- wp-feed.php | 4 ++-- wp-includes/canonical.php | 2 +-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/wp-feed.php b/wp-feed.php index 78daa6d22..24cd8d672 100644 --- a/wp-feed.php +++ b/wp-feed.php @@ -1,12 +1,12 @@ \ No newline at end of file diff --git a/wp-includes/canonical.php b/wp-includes/canonical.php index b4c8fcfe4..7d7da1bc8 100644 --- a/wp-includes/canonical.php +++ b/wp-includes/canonical.php @@ -190,7 +190,7 @@ function redirect_canonical($requested_url=null, $do_redirect=true) { $addl_path = !empty( $addl_path ) ? trailingslashit($addl_path) : ''; if ( get_query_var( 'withcomments' ) ) $addl_path .= 'comments/'; - $addl_path .= user_trailingslashit( 'feed/' . ( ( 'rss2' == get_query_var('feed') || 'feed' == get_query_var('feed') ) ? '' : get_query_var('feed') ), 'feed' ); + $addl_path .= user_trailingslashit( 'feed/' . ( ( get_default_feed() == get_query_var('feed') || 'feed' == get_query_var('feed') ) ? '' : get_query_var('feed') ), 'feed' ); $redirect['query'] = remove_query_arg( 'feed', $redirect['query'] ); }